EPIK Communications announces IP-on-Wave OC-192 backbone

April 12, 2001
Apr. 12, 2001--EPIK Communications Incorporated, the telecommunications subsidiary of Florida East Coast Industries, Inc. announced the launch of its next generation IP-on-Wave OC-192 backbone.

EPIK will now offer high performance IP services on its 10 Gigabit network, which connects Miami, Orlando, Tampa, Jacksonville and Atlanta.

Last month, EPIK announced its plan to offer Internet Protocol (IP) services through an integrated portfolio of enlightened IP services on its OC-192 IP backbone. EPIK is now providing to its customers a suite of IP services that includes Dedicated Internet Access and Ethernet Transport. EPIK's Ethernet Transport service enables customers to connect multiple sites using an Ethernet connection of 100Mbps or 1Gbps. In the future, EPIK plans to introduce 10Gbps Ethernet service. EPIK will also offer IP Virtual Private Network (IP VPN) and other advanced IP services later in the year.

Airwire.net, Inc. is EPIK's first Dedicated Internet Access IP customer with a Fast-Ethernet (100Mbps) connection.

About EPIK Communications Incorporated:

EPIK Communications operates as a carriers' carrier, providing wholesale carrier services including bandwidth (private lines), wave services, Internet Protocol services, collocation and dark fiber to long distance carriers, international carriers, wireless and cellular carriers, Internet Service Providers (ISPs) and Competitive Local Exchange Carriers (CLECs).
